InglêsFrancêsEspanhol

Ad


favicon do OnWorks

dctimestep - Online na nuvem

Execute dctimestep no provedor de hospedagem gratuita OnWorks no Ubuntu Online, Fedora Online, emulador online do Windows ou emulador online do MAC OS

Este é o comando dctimestep que pode ser executado no provedor de hospedagem gratuita OnWorks usando uma de nossas várias estações de trabalho online gratuitas, como Ubuntu Online, Fedora Online, emulador online do Windows ou emulador online do MAC OS

PROGRAMA:

NOME


dctimestep - calcula passo de tempo de simulação anual por meio de multiplicação de matriz

SINOPSE


dctimestep Especificação DC [ skyvec ]
dctimestep Vspec Tbsdf.xml Dmat.dat [ skyvec ]

DESCRIÇÃO


Passo de tempo tem dois formulários de invocação. Na primeira forma, dctimestep recebe luz do dia
especificação de coeficiente e um vetor céu opcional, que pode ser lido a partir do padrão
entrada se não for especificado. Os coeficientes de luz do dia são multiplicados contra este vetor e
os resultados são gravados na saída padrão. Pode ser uma lista de valores de cores ou um
imagem Radiance combinada, conforme explicado abaixo.

Na segunda forma, dctimestep leva quatro arquivos de entrada, formando uma expressão de matriz. o
o primeiro argumento é o arquivo de matriz de visualização que especifica como as direções de saída da janela são
relacionado a algum conjunto de valores medidos, como uma matriz de pontos de iluminância ou imagens.
Esta matriz é geralmente calculada por rtcontrib(1) para um determinado conjunto de janelas ou
aberturas de claraboias. O segundo argumento é a matriz de transmissão da janela, ou BSDF, dado
como uma descrição XML padrão. O terceiro argumento é o arquivo de matriz Daylight que
define como as manchas do céu se relacionam com as direções de entrada na mesma abertura. Isso geralmente é
calculado usando Genklemsamp(1) com rtcontrib em uma execução separada para cada janela ou claraboia
orientação. A entrada final é o vetor de contribuição do céu, geralmente calculado por
Genskyvec(1) que pode ser passado na entrada padrão. Esses dados devem estar em ASCII
formato, enquanto as matrizes de visualização e luz do dia são mais eficientemente representadas como binárias
dados flutuantes se a ordem de bytes da máquina não for um problema.

Enviado para a saída padrão de dctimestep é um vetor de cores ASCII com tantos RGB
trigêmeos, pois há linhas na matriz de exibição, ou um combinado Esplendor foto. Que
a saída é produzida depende do primeiro argumento. Um nome de arquivo normal será carregado e
interpretado como uma matriz para gerar um vetor de resultados de cores. Uma especificação de arquivo
contendo uma string de formato '% d' será interpretado como uma lista de Esplendor componente
imagens, que serão somadas de acordo com o vetor calculado.

EXEMPLOS


Para calcular as iluminâncias do plano de trabalho às 3h30 do dia 10 de fevereiro:

gensky 2 10 15:30 | genskyvec | dctimestep workplaneDC.dmx> Ill_02-10-1530.dat

Para calcular uma imagem às 10h no equinócio a partir de um conjunto de imagens componentes:

gensky 3 21 10 | genskyvec | dctimestep viewc% 03d.hdr> view_03-21-10.hdr

Para calcular um conjunto de contribuições de iluminância para a janela 1 no solstício de inverno às 2h:

gensky 12 21 14 | genskyvec | dctimestep IllPts.vmx Blinds20.xml Window1.dmx>
III_12-21-14.dat

Para calcular a contribuição de Window2 para uma vista interna ao meio-dia no solstício de verão:

gensky 6 21 12 | genskyvec | dctimestep view% 03d.hdr Blinds30.xml Window2.dmx>
visualizar_6-21-12.hdr

Use dctimestep online usando serviços onworks.net


Servidores e estações de trabalho gratuitos

Baixar aplicativos Windows e Linux

  • 1
    Carregador de inicialização Clover EFI
    Carregador de inicialização Clover EFI
    O projeto mudou para
    https://github.com/CloverHackyColor/CloverBootloader..
    Recursos: Inicialize macOS, Windows e Linux
    no modo UEFI ou legado no Mac ou PC com
    EU...
    Baixe o gerenciador de boot Clover EFI
  • 2
    Unitedrpms
    Unitedrpms
    Junte-se a nós no Gitter!
    https://gitter.im/unitedrpms-people/Lobby
    Habilite o repositório URPMS em seu
    sistema -
    https://github.com/UnitedRPMs/unitedrpms.github.io/bl...
    Baixar unitedrpms
  • 3
    Boost C ++ Bibliotecas
    Boost C ++ Bibliotecas
    Boost fornece portátil gratuito
    bibliotecas C++ revisadas por pares. o
    ênfase está em bibliotecas portáteis que
    funcionam bem com a biblioteca padrão C++.
    Veja http://www.bo...
    Baixar bibliotecas Boost C++
  • 4
    VirtualGL
    VirtualGL
    O VirtualGL redireciona comandos 3D de um
    Aplicativo Unix / Linux OpenGL em um
    GPU do lado do servidor e converte o
    imagens 3D renderizadas em um stream de vídeo
    com qual ...
    Baixar VirtualGL
  • 5
    libusb
    libusb
    Biblioteca para habilitar o espaço do usuário
    programas de aplicativos para se comunicar com
    Dispositivos USB. Público: Desenvolvedores, Fim
    Usuários/Desktop. Linguagem de programação: C.
    Categorias ...
    Baixar libusb
  • 6
    GOLE
    GOLE
    SWIG é uma ferramenta de desenvolvimento de software
    que conecta programas escritos em C e
    C ++ com uma variedade de alto nível
    linguagens de programação. SWIG é usado com
    diferente...
    Baixar SWIG
  • Mais "

Comandos Linux

Ad